Understanding the Relationship Between Feet and Yards
The foundation of any unit conversion lies in understanding the defined relationship between the units involved. In the imperial system, the relationship between feet and yards is as follows:
- 1 yard = 3 feet
This simple equation is the key to performing all conversions between these two units. Remembering this core relationship will make all future conversions straightforward and intuitive.
Calculating 12 Feet to Yards: A Step-by-Step Approach
Now, let's tackle the central question: how many yards are there in 12 feet? We can solve this using the fundamental relationship we established above.
Step 1: Recall the Conversion Factor:
Remember that 1 yard is equivalent to 3 feet. This is the crucial conversion factor we will use.
Step 2: Set up the Conversion:
We can set up a simple equation to perform the conversion:
12 feet * (1 yard / 3 feet) = ? yards
Notice how we set up the equation to cancel out the "feet" units. The "feet" unit is in the numerator of the first term and the denominator of the second term, allowing them to cancel each other out, leaving us with the desired unit: yards Small thing, real impact. Nothing fancy..
Step 3: Perform the Calculation:
Simply perform the arithmetic:
12 feet * (1 yard / 3 feet) = 4 yards
So, 12 feet is equal to 4 yards It's one of those things that adds up. Turns out it matters..

Expanding Your Understanding: Converting Other Units of Length
The principle of unit conversion extends far beyond feet and yards. The same approach can be applied to convert between other units of length, such as:
-
Inches to Feet: There are 12 inches in 1 foot. To convert inches to feet, you divide the number of inches by 12.
-
Feet to Miles: There are 5280 feet in 1 mile. To convert feet to miles, you divide the number of feet by 5280 Easy to understand, harder to ignore. Simple as that..
-
Meters to Yards: This involves a slightly more complex conversion factor, as the metric and imperial systems have different base units. You'll need to use the appropriate conversion factor (approximately 1 meter = 1.0936 yards).
-
Centimeters to Inches: There are 2.54 centimeters in 1 inch. To convert centimeters to inches, you divide the number of centimeters by 2.54 Small thing, real impact..
Mastering these conversions involves understanding the fundamental relationships between units and applying the appropriate conversion factors.
